WebSize of the Ovaries. The Common Vein copyright 2008. Introduction. In general, Post-menarchal ovaries measure 2.5-5 cm in length, and 1.5 to 3 cm. in width and depth. Volume generally is Because of the ovary has a variable, usually oval shape, size is best expressed as an estimated volume.

WebMay 3, 2024 · Ovary size and volume is frequently determined with ultrasound.The volume estimate is calculated by the formula for an ellipsoid, where D 1, D 2, and D 3 are the three axial measurements:. D 1 x D 2 x D 3 x 0.52. The normal, adult, non-pregnant, mean ovary volume of women who are not postmenopausal is 6-7 mL based on several studies which … WebDec 6, 2024 · Menstrual flow might occur every 21 to 35 days and last two to seven days. WebSep 24, 2024 · The ovaries are small, oval-shaped, and grayish in color, with an uneven surface. The actual size of an ovary depends on a woman’s age and hormonal status; the ovaries, covered by a modified peritoneum, are approximately 3-5 cm in length during childbearing years and become much smaller and then atrophic once menopause occurs.

The primary female reproductive organs, or gonads, are the two ovaries. Each ovary is a solid, ovoid structure about the size and shape of an almond, about 3.5 cm in length, 2 cm wide, and 1 cm thick.
